Output 39dee4d52db10cadd257112b86cd53de79f7da52dd255b8cd367fbae52fb5bbf:2

value
75360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f527f5a7d0f7539a9e6f329c70014dec55d6c6b OP_EQUAL
address
3K8dpD3FJEttMRxs5DCAtDNHhJHberAU4P
transaction
39dee4d52db10cadd257112b86cd53de79f7da52dd255b8cd367fbae52fb5bbf
confirmations
251873
spent
true